    Opera Discovery Records presents the world premiere recording of Pasquale di Cagno's opera Maremma (c 1930). Urged by Puccini, who hosted him in his "La Tagliata" estate in Ansedonia, to write a work on the Maremma region and to use Giuseppe Adami as librettist, Pasquale di Cagno waited a few years before beginning this project.

    Di Cagno submitted his work, entitledMaremma, at the Scala under the pseudonym of Costante Costanti. The ploy failed and his score was rejected, as were the following submissions, determining an authentic ostracism towards the Apulian composer's music. Embittered, di Cagno withdrew from composing while remaining tied to the world of music. In the 1960s there was a sudden interest in his work which culminated in the first performances of theMaremmaon Italian Radio in 1966 conduced by Pietro Argentowith Angela Vercelli and Luigi Infantinothen at the Teatro Petruzzelli in Bari in 1968. Unfortunately, the composer could not rejoice in their success because he had sadly died a few years previously.

    The story takes place near the ancient city of Ansedonia, in Maremma. Giose, a shepherd in love with Mara, killed the groom whom the old father Turi had destined for the girl. Trembling and insecure Mara joins him in the forest, led by a sheperd. Meanwhile Turi rushes to avenge the honor of his family. With the proud accents of the ancient patriarchs he claims the right to give his daughter a husband of his choice and deplores Giose's violence. Enraged, Giose strangles him after a furious quarrel and apathetically concedes himself to the judgement and revenge of the community.
